Derrick Nsibambi Set For Spell In Ethiopia

Uganda Cranes striker Derrick Nsibambi is set to join a club in Ethiopia.

Cranes coach Milutin Micho Sredejovich slighly let the cat out of the bag on Tuesday.

We are having certain challenges and those challenges go into direction that some important players unfortunately they do not settle themselves from a point of having their ckubs and playing whatsoever.

“Nsibambi is in similar situation (with Emmanuel Okwi) as his Egyptian contract expired. He is now getting a new club in Ethiopia,” Micho said o Tuesday after the morning training session.

Nsibambi joined Smouha in June 2018, signing a three year deal then, from KCCA FC.

The forward was influential for KCCA FC where he won the Uganda Premier League title and the Uganda Cup in the 2017/2018 season, and also helped the side reach the group stage of the 2018 CAF Champions League.

One of Ethiopian Coffee and St George is expected to be the likely destinations for Nsibambi.
